Waratahs farewell 2024/25 at annual presentation night

The Manly Warringah Waratahs farewelled a highly successful 2024/25 season at the annual presentation evening on Saturday 13 April.

Returning to the Manly Pacific, more than 200 guests — including current and former players, partners, and family members — gathered to celebrate another fantastic year.

MC duties were carried out by women’s coaching staff member and media extraordinaire Matt White, who did a fantastic job throughout the night.

As always, the evening began with Club President Andrew Fraser, who delivered a strong overview of another successful season for the Tahs.

From there, the awards kicked off, with batting and bowling honours presented to standout performers from each team, along with club-wide performance awards. For the full list of winners, see below.

Following the dinner break, some of the club’s most prestigious awards were presented — including the George Lowe Medal, which was awarded to Holly Searles.

This award recognises the player who has contributed most to the local community. It is named in honour of George Lowe, whose service to cricket on the Northern Beaches and to the Manly Club was truly outstanding.

Club great and life member Sam Mesite received the President’s Award, presented by Andrew Fraser. Sam has been an integral part of the club for many years and, more recently, has played a key role in the coaching staff as both batting coach and “net captain.”

The Senior Women’s Player of the Year was awarded to Ella McCaughan, who had a fantastic season and was instrumental in the success of our W1s side.

The parents of the late Michael “Juice” Shepheard were invited on stage to present the Michael “Juice” Shepheard Senior Male Player of the Year award, which was fittingly won by Ahillen Beadle.

Our PGS and 4th Grade premiership-winning captains and teams were then invited on stage to receive their premiership medals.

The Women’s Players’ Player was awarded to Arabella Handley, while Adam Searle took home the Men’s Players’ Player. Both featured prominently in the point scoring throughout the night, demonstrating their consistency throughout the season.

The evening concluded with 4th Grade skipper Adam Parkinson being honoured as the 2024/25 Keith Marks Clubman of the Year.

Parko has been a massive part of our club — not only on the field, where he has now won a record six premierships for the Tahs — but also through his work in developing the club’s future stars in his role as 4th Grade captain. Congratulations, Parko, on this well-deserved achievement.
